How to compare the best options in your region
When comparing models, consider total cost of ownership, including upfront price, ink or toner costs, service agreements, and warranty terms. Read user reviews focused on reliability and real-world performance rather than specs alone. If possible, test print a diverse mix of documents to gauge speed, clarity, and color accuracy. Local retailers and authorized service centers in Sri Lanka can offer hands-on guidance, ensuring you select a device that meets both technical requirements and regional support expectations.
